In Episode 4 of The Brenton Peck Podcast, I’m joined by Ben Blessing—composer, educator, ultra-endurance runner, former Marine Corps musician, and current service member in the Idaho Army National Guard’s 25th Army Band.We explore:His musical roots and teaching path: Growing up in Meridian, Idaho, discovering composition in junior high, earning degrees in Music Composition and Music Education, and now directing the band in Baker City, Oregon.Service through music: Playing euphonium in the Marine Corps Band at Parris Island and continuing to perform with the 25th Army Band.Creative voice and recognition: Writing for concert band, orchestra, choir, and electronic media, with works like Symphony No. 4, Grandma’s Coat, and Standhope Peak earning national acclaim and competition wins.Running ultra-marathons: From training for extreme races like the 135-mile challenge while in the Marines to serving as Race Director for the Standhope Ultra Challenge—and the endurance it takes to juggle composing, teaching, service, and family.Community & legacy: How his dual passions for music and running support local programs—like helping Baker High School’s band—and shape his disciplined, purpose-driven life.This episode is a story of discipline meeting creativity, of finding harmony between art and grit, stage and trail.🌐 Connect with Ben Blessing:Website → benblessing.comYouTube → youtube.com/@benblessingInstagram → instagram.com/trailthrasherTikTok → tiktok.com/@standhopeultraStrava → strava.app.link/ZuSiG3iriWbBluesky → bsky.app/profile/benblessing.bsky.socialFacebook → facebook.com/ben.blessing.958872🔗 All podcast links: www.brentonpeckpodcast.com👉 Watch full episodes on YouTube/Spotify👉 Follow on Instagram, TikTok, and X👉 Join the community on Facebook#brentonpeckpodcast #benblessing #composer #banddirector #ultramarathonrunner #musiceducation #ultrarunning
